J Gudda secured the win with a strong showing in the second and third rounds, consistently delivering bars and maintaining an aggressive stage presence. While Yung Cos impressed some with his freestyle ability, especially early on, the consensus among fans was that J Gudda's more structured approach and wordplay ultimately edged out his opponent.

Round-by-Round
Rd 1Yung CosYung Cos started strong, with several fans noting his impactful delivery and un-rehearsed bars in the opening round, giving him an early edge.
Rd 2J GuddaJ Gudda found his rhythm in the second, with fans praising his consistent bars and aggressive performance, which began to sway the momentum in his favor.
Rd 3J GuddaJ Gudda closed out the battle decisively, with his wordplay and structured approach proving too much for Yung Cos, whose freestyle-heavy delivery in this round was seen by many as a detriment.
Analysis

The No Excuses stage played host to a gritty matchup between J Gudda and Yung Cos, a battle that saw two distinct styles clash. Yung Cos came out swinging, impressing many with his raw freestyle energy and charisma in the first round, hinting at a potential upset. His un-rehearsed delivery and relatable persona resonated with a segment of the audience, who felt he brought an authentic street vibe to the platform.

However, as the battle progressed, J Gudda's seasoned approach began to take hold. His consistent bar work, aggressive stage presence, and intricate wordplay proved to be the difference-maker. While Yung Cos's freestyle was commendable, particularly for a debut, J Gudda's more structured and polished performance in the second and third rounds allowed him to pull away, ultimately securing the victory in the eyes of most viewers.

The battle served as a solid showcase for both emcees, with J Gudda solidifying his reputation and Yung Cos demonstrating promising potential for future appearances.

What fans loved
  • J Gudda's consistent bars and aggressive stage presence were frequently highlighted by fans.
  • Many viewers praised J Gudda's wordplay and overall performance, especially in the later rounds.
  • Yung Cos received commendation for his freestyle ability and charisma, particularly in the opening round.
  • Some fans appreciated Yung Cos's authentic and relatable style, noting it was his first battle.
Criticisms
  • Yung Cos's reliance on freestyle in the later rounds was widely seen as a weakness that impacted his overall delivery.
  • Several comments suggested Yung Cos would benefit from writing his material more thoroughly for future battles.
  • A few viewers expressed that J Gudda's bars, while effective, were not as strong as his previous performances.
  • Some comments raised questions about the originality of J Gudda's material.
